The Pak-Afghan border at Torkham has been opened to allow Pakistanis stranded in Afghanistan to return. The decision was taken on the orders of the Pakistani Interior Ministry, the District Police Officer (DPO) said on Saturday.
The DPO said the Pakistanis returning from Afghanistan are being permitted entrance only after all relevant SOPs are followed.
“Entrants are transferred to quarantine centres for precautionary measures,” he stated.
Last month, Pakistan had opened its Torkham and Chaman border crossings for four days to allow Afghan nationals in the country to return home.
